Transaction c5841fa660876cb84fb9306aadd20d2c393c26acf196e21ac153ba6b7134336a
1 Input
1 Output
-
c5841fa660876cb84fb9306aadd20d2c393c26acf196e21ac153ba6b7134336a:0
- value
- 589245
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5f259852eb04568541b82ca74f05352f6c8a9c3
- address
- bc1q5he9npfwkpzks4qmst98fuzn2tmv32wryj6ha3